Heathrow is looking for a Principal Electrical Engineer to lead the development of our electrification strategy and future electrical infrastructure. You will be accountable for creating asset system strategies, ensuring safety and delivering measurable business benefits.

Successful candidates will demonstrate Chartered Engineer status and proven experience in the asset management field. We offer competitive salaries, generous annual leave, and a commitment to sustainability and career growth.
